Oscar Wilde

The truth is rarely pure and never simple.

Hearts live by being wounded.

One should always play fairly when one has the winning cards.

The only thing to do with good advice is to pass it on. It is never of any use to oneself.

I see when men love women, they give them but a little of their lives. But women, when they love give everything.

Fashion is a form of ugliness so intolerable that we have to alter it every six months.

Some cause happiness wherever they go; others, whenever they go.

Truth, in matters of religion, is simply the opinion that has survived.

Democracy means simply the bludgeoning of the people by the people for the people.

Men marry because they are tired; women, because they are curious; both are disappointed.
